
深度解析美国站群服务器的架构与部署技巧
2025-02-18 13:56
阅读量:61
美国站群服务器的架构与部署涉及多个技术层面和最佳实践,适用于需要大量网站或应用程序的企业。以下是对美国站群服务器架构的深度解析及部署技巧。
1. 站群服务器的基本概念
站群服务器是指在同一网络或数据中心内,通过多个服务器托管多个网站或应用。这种方式可以提高资源利用率、增强网站性能并支持SEO策略。
2. 架构设计
a. 服务器类型
- VPS(虚拟专用服务器):适合中小型网站,成本较低且灵活性高。
- 独立服务器:适合资源消耗大、流量高的网站,提供专属资源。
- 云服务器:提供更高的可扩展性和灵活性,适合快速变化的需求。
b. 网络拓扑
- 负载均衡:使用负载均衡器(如 Nginx 或 HAProxy)分配流量,提高性能和可用性。
- CDN(内容分发网络):通过 CDN 缓存静态内容,减少服务器负担并提高全球访问速度。
c. 数据库架构
- 主从复制:设置主数据库和多个从数据库,提高读操作性能和数据冗余。
- 分片技术:将数据分散到多个数据库实例中,适用于大规模数据处理。
3. 部署技巧
a. 使用容器化技术
- Docker:使用 Docker 容器化应用,简化部署和管理,确保环境一致性。
- Kubernetes:使用 Kubernetes 编排容器,自动化部署、扩展和管理。
b. 自动化部署工具
- Ansible、Chef 或 Puppet:使用这些工具自动化服务器配置和应用部署,减少人为错误。
- CI/CD:实施持续集成和持续交付(CI/CD)流程,确保代码快速、可靠地部署。
c. 安全措施
- 防火墙和入侵检测:配置防火墙和入侵检测系统(如 Fail2Ban)保护服务器免受攻击。
- SSL/TLS 加密:为所有网站启用 SSL/TLS 加密,保护用户数据和网站安全。
4. 监控与维护
a. 性能监控
- 使用工具(如 Prometheus、Grafana 或 Zabbix)监控服务器性能和应用状态,及时发现问题。
- 监控网络流量、CPU 使用率、内存和磁盘空间等关键指标。
b. 定期备份
- 实施定期数据备份策略,确保在出现故障时能够快速恢复。
- 将备份存储在异地位置,防止数据丢失。
c. 日志管理
- 集中管理和分析日志(如使用 ELK Stack),帮助识别安全问题和性能瓶颈。
5. SEO 优化
- IP 多样性:通过使用不同美国多 IP 地址的服务器,避免被搜索引擎视为黑帽 SEO。
- 内容优化:确保每个网站的内容独特且高质量,避免重复内容导致的排名下降。
6. 总结
成功部署和管理美国站群服务器需要综合考虑架构设计、技术选型、安全措施以及监控与维护。通过实施上述技巧,可以提高站群的性能、可扩展性和安全性,从而支持业务的持续增长和发展。定期评估和优化架构,将有助于应对不断变化的市场需求和技术挑战。
- Tags:
- 美国站群服务器,美国多IP,美国站群,站群服务器
上一篇:如何利用美国站群服务器实现多IP站点的SEO优化
下一篇:美国站群服务器不能正常关机/重启是怎么回事